Double-Hung vs. Single-Hung Windows Both single-hung and double-hung home windows are the types that have a reduced sash (or pane) that glides up. When the home gets as well hot, you can unlock the window and glide the lower sash up. With solitary hung home windows, the upper sash is taken care of in place and also unusable.

Setup Information on Full-Frame Substitute Windows, During the setup of a full-frame substitute home window, the whole home window is gotten rid of, leaving only the harsh opening" like in a new home building and construction.

A full-frame setup is advised when there is considerable rot or damage to the outside timber components of a window opening. Sometimes, a full-frame installment is the very best choice because of the glass loss with an insert replacement home window. Because of the amount of additional materials as well as work that are needed in a full-frame home window installment, it will cost more.
